AAU (Amateur Athletic Union) basketball games are known for their competitive atmosphere and the opportunity they provide young athletes to showcase their talents at a high level. Popping off in an AAU game typically means a standout performance characterized by scoring, defense, or game-changing plays that capture attention. From my experience, excelling in an AAU game requires intense preparation, focus, and a strong mental game. It’s not just about physical skill but also about understanding your teammates, reading your opponents, and seizing critical moments. Performing well in these games can open doors for scholarships and further opportunities in basketball. Many players share similar stories of personal bests and breakout performances in AAU events.
